Shanghai continues to optimise COVID control measures


Close contacts of COVID-19 cases can undergo home quarantine if their living conditions meet quarantine requirements or opt to go to a quarantine facility for five days, Shanghai authorities announced on Wednesday as part of its latest adjusted COVID-19 prevention and control measures.
To those currently under centralised quarantine with eligible living condition, they can be transferred back to home to finish isolation.
Requirements of a COVID test upon arrival are lifted for domestic travellers to the city.
Notification saying "less than five days upon arrival" on domestic traveler's health and venue code pages will be canceled, while prohibition of their entries into certain public venues such as malls and supermarkets will also be lifted.
The new protocol will take effect since Thursday.
